PRESS RELEASE — Quantum X Labs Inc. (Nasdaq: QXL) (“Quantum X Labs” or the “Company”), an advanced quantum technologies company, and IQCC, a Quantum Machines company, today announced the signing of a strategic cooperation agreement, under which Quantum X Labs will evaluate its AI-based quantum error-correction technology on Quantum Machines’ quantum control infrastructure. The primary objective is to run Quantum X Labs’ proprietary AI-driven error correction algorithm in a fully integrated hardware-software environment.
The collaboration will test Quantum X Labs’ AI-based decoding technology using IQCC’s quantum computing infrastructure, with the goal of exploring its applicability to future quantum error-correction workflows.
IQCC will provide access to its quantum control and orchestration infrastructure, including the OPX1000 real-time quantum controller, used by leading quantum research institutions and commercial quantum-computing programs worldwide. IQCC’s systems are designed to support future low-latency feedback and quantum error-correction workflows.
